原文:第二章-Python 实现 获取app 冷热启动时间脚本

首先先回顾一下部分需要使用到的adb命令 adb devices 查看连接设备 adb shell logcat grep START 查看监听 adb shell am start W n 包 包ity 启动app 并且 查看时间 adb shell am force stop 包名 关闭app adb shell input keyevent home 键返回 代码如下 ...

2017-04-12 16:53 0 1629 推荐指数:

查看详情

1、获取APP 冷/热启动时间

最近在研究Android APP性能测试。所以发现一些有趣的东西,在这里进行分享。我们先讲第一个内容,如何获取APP冷/热启动时间?为什么要做这个测试,道理其实很简单,如果启动APP特别耗时的话,用户反馈百分之99不好。所以在这里我们可以获取APP冷/热启动时间,同竞品进行比较。 环境准备 ...

Tue Jul 31 00:36:00 CST 2018 0 1596
获取app启动时间

启动APP并收集消耗时间的命令: adb shell am start -W -n package/activity 手动关闭谷歌浏览器APP(也可以使用命令关闭adb shell am force-stop 包名),使用启动命令来自动启动谷歌APP,见下图运行结果,可以看到有启动谷歌浏览器 ...

Tue Aug 28 08:46:00 CST 2018 0 1340
第二章 时间控件(DateTime Picker)

  这家伙太懒了,碰到问题才写博文,嘿嘿。   好了进入正题,二话不说,先放地址:   中文:http://www.bootcss.com/p/bootstrap-datetimepicker/i ...

Fri Oct 18 06:07:00 CST 2013 3 68953
第二章 consul的安装和启动

安装环境: mac:64bit(查看mac位数:打开终端-->"uname -a") consul_0.6.4_darwin_amd64.zip和consul_0.6.4_web_u ...

Wed Apr 06 04:45:00 CST 2016 0 27309
获取Android手机app启动时间

经过一天的摸索,终于找到怎么处理了,对于一个自动化技术不高的小白来说,还是挺有成就感的,哈哈 1. 手机链接电脑时遇到的问题,设备一直显示不出来,运行命令adb devices,只显示:List o ...

Thu Jul 04 17:39:00 CST 2019 1 793
【原创】Python第二章——行与缩进

Python的基本组成——逻辑行和缩进 Python程序的最基本的组成元素是语句,一条语句可以占有一个物理行,过长的语句可以占有多个物理行,此时这多个物理行组成了一个逻辑行,它们在物理上虽然跨越多行,但是逻辑上是属于同一部分。每个物理行 ...

Wed May 20 23:58:00 CST 2015 2 16742
第二章 python基本语法元素

python有两种编程方式,交互式和文件式。 交互式:对每个输入语句即时运行结果------适合语法练习 文件式:批量执行一组语句并运行结果------编程的主要方式 实例1:圆面积的计算(根据半径r计算圆面积) 上图明显是交互式运行的结果,如果想编辑文件式运行,则先编辑一个 ...

Thu Aug 09 05:45:00 CST 2018 0 2063
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M